DVCC provides comprehensive services in a four county area in north-central North Dakota.The counties DVCC serves are: Ward (including the Minot Air Force Base), Pierce, McHenry, and Renville.

We’re proud to celebrate our Executive Director, Jill McDonald, who served as a keynote speaker this week at the North Dakota Association of Nonprofits Conference alongside Christy Miller, Director of Souris Valley United Way.

Together, they shared the powerful “First Lead Yourself” philosophy—encouraging nonprofit professionals to prioritize their own well-being, recognize the signs of burnout, and create a plan for navigating the challenges that come with serving others.

Nonprofit work is meaningful, but it can also be demanding. Jill and Christy’s message was a reminder that sustainable leadership starts with caring for ourselves so we can continue caring for our communities.
